Having just played yesterday, the Asheville Christian Academy Lions will get right back to it and host the Brevard Blue Devils at 8:00 p.m. on Friday. Asheville Christian Academy will be strutting in after a win while Brevard will be coming in after a loss.
It was a proper cat-fight when Asheville Christian Academy took on Carolina Day on Thursday. Asheville Christian Academy blew past Carolina Day, posting a 73-19 victory. The Lions have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won eight matches by 21 points or more this season.
Meanwhile, after some red-hot attacks on offense in their last four contests, Brevard finally came back down to earth on Wednesday. They were dealt a 72-29 defeat at the hands of East Henderson. The game marked the Blue Devils' lowest-scoring match so far this season.
Asheville Christian Academy is on a roll lately: they've won six of their last seven contests, which provided a nice bump to their 15-5 record this season.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 65.6 points per game. As for Brevard, their loss dropped their record down to 6-9.
Everything came up roses for Asheville Christian Academy against Brevard in their previous meeting back in February of 2024, as the squad secured a 78-47 win.
